Abstract
A system and method for providing data to a model of a building system includes a building control system with a communications network, a control subsystem for generating module deployment data and transmitting the module deployment data over the communications network, a memory for storing a three dimensional model of at least a portion of a building and a computer. A computer program executed by the computer includes computer instructions for associating module deployment data received from the communications network with the three dimensional model and modifying the three dimensional model based upon the module deployment data.

6. A method of populating a model of at least a portion of a building comprising:
-
enabling communication between a module and a building control subsystem integrated into a communications network;
the module performing a building system control operation;positioning the module at a desired location; determining the position of the module; transmitting data indicative of the determined position of the module through the communications network; associating the transmitted data with a virtual position associated with a model of at least a portion of a building; and modifying the model to include the module at the virtual position. - View Dependent Claims (7, 8, 9, 10, 11)

12. A method of entering a representation of a micro electromechanical system module into a building model comprising:
-
activating a micro electromechanical configured to perform a building control system operation system module; positioning the micro electromechanical system module at a desired sensor location; integrating the micro electromechanical system module into a building control subsystem; generating data indicative of a geographic position of the positioned micro electromechanical system module; transmitting the generated data through a communications network; and modifying a three dimensional building model based upon the transmitted data to include a representation of the micro electromechanical system module at a virtual location in the three dimensional building that corresponds to the geographic position of the positioned micro electromechanical system module. - View Dependent Claims (13, 14, 15, 16, 17, 18)
